I have created another Litchi mission utility. This utility is used to create partial panorama missions. Google Earth Pro is used to define the focal point of the panorama. Controls are used to define the width and height of the partial panorama.

I know that many of you capture partial panorama photos manually by visually overlapping a series of photos. That may be the preferred method for some. For those of you who would like to pre-plan a mission to capture one or more sets of partial panorama photos, this utility will make that process possible.
Some of you fly drones that are only supported with DJI Fly waypoints. I also have a converter that can convert these Litchi missions into DJI Fly waypoint missions.
